growth rate
Compared to other types of privet, the gold privet grows moderately fast. Nevertheless, its annual growth is impressive at 30 to 60 cm. This increment applies equally to height and width.
height
Different information can be found regarding the maximum achievable height. While some nurseries assume 2.5 m in height, others promise more. Occasionally, with appropriate upbringing and care, there is talk of up to 5 m. Of course, the height is also a question of age and the living conditions under which the gold privet has to grow.

broad
The Goldliguster is growing in width as well as in height at the same rapid pace. On average, it reaches a diameter of 1 to 1.5 m. However, it can also be 2 m. for one
Hedge, 2-3 plants per meter are recommended. Here the plants set each other narrower boundaries.
growth habit
This shrub grows well branched. The branches grow upright. Its growth form is described as vase-shaped. But the gold privet owes its final shape to the scissors. He often uses this. On the one hand, cutting is useful to limit it in height and width. On the other hand, this encourages dense branching.
A gold privet can even be raised with scissors in such a way that it grows as a standard tree with a round, well-formed crown.
Factors promoting growth
How well the gold privet grows depends on its location and
the care he gets. While it is well formed in any location, its variegation suffers considerably when there is a lack of light. He turns green.
It grows particularly well in a humus-rich, nutrient-rich substrate. Although it tolerates slightly acidic soil, the plant loves lime and grows faster with this element. The following factors also have a favorable effect on its growth:
- a deeply loosened soil without a tendency to waterlogging
- regular fertilizing from March to mid-August
